Just wondering you know they are all 2.4ghz frequency, so do they have crystals ??

And if they don't how does the receiver know what to pick up ??

I am basically trying to ask how do they differentiate from each other ??

It knows which reciver to use by "binding" the TX to the RX. When you first get it you bind them and the RX is a give a code by the TX so i knows only to use that code. When you switch it on the TX finds the RX and then looks for a free channel with the 2.4 ghz specktrum (theres 79 i think) once it finds one it locks and bobs your uncle...at least thats how i think it works :confused:
